<div class="ubbcode-block"><div class="ubbcode-header">Originally Posted By: AJ300MAG</div><div class="ubbcode-body">If you have access to a mill make one... </div></div>
1-1/8" thick CRS. Bore hole to 1.355", split. Mill notch down to bottom of radius 1.180" wide. Drill&tap for 1/2-20 SHCS's. Have someone that knows how to weld, 1" diameter CRS handle 18" long. Wrench fits action behind the recoil lug. Enjoy...
